The intersection of body positivity and the wellness lifestyle has transformed from a radical political movement into a mainstream cultural shift that prioritizes mental health alongside physical vitality.

This detailed review examines the evolution, benefits, and current tensions within this space. 1. The Core Philosophy

Body positivity advocates for the acceptance of all bodies regardless of size, shape, or ability. When merged with wellness, it shifts the focus from "fixing" a body to "honoring" it through:

Intuitive Eating: Listening to internal hunger and fullness cues rather than following restrictive diets.

Joyful Movement: Exercising for energy, mood, and strength instead of calorie burning or weight loss.

Holistic Health: Recognizing that mental well-being is as critical to health as physical markers. 2. Historical Context & Evolution The movement has evolved through distinct phases: The Myth of the "Before" Photo The wellness

1960s (Origins): Rooted in fat activism and civil rights, led primarily by Black, fat, and queer women fighting for systemic dignity.

1990s: Focused on exercise inclusivity, creating safe spaces for larger bodies to move without shame.

2010s–Present: Social media popularized the movement, though critics argue it has been co-opted by brands to sell a "commercialized" version of self-love that often excludes the very people who started it. What is the history of body positivity? - BBC Bitesize


The Great Misunderstanding: Body Neutrality vs. Body Positivity

Before we merge body positivity with wellness, we must address the elephant in the room (and love that elephant exactly as it is). Many people reject body positivity because they find the premise unrealistic. "How," they ask, "am I supposed to love my cellulite or my chronic illness?"

This is where the concept of Body Neutrality offers a bridge.

  • Body Positivity: "I love my body and everything it does."
  • Body Neutrality: "I appreciate what my body can do, but I don't need to love every inch of it to treat it with respect."

A successful wellness lifestyle rooted in body acceptance is not about forcing toxic positivity. It is about moving from a place of shame to a place of respect.

When you exercise because you hate your stomach, you operate from a deficit. That motivation is fleeting and often leads to injury or burnout. When you exercise because you respect your body’s need for movement, you operate from abundance. This subtle shift is the foundation of the Body Positive Wellness Lifestyle.

For Bodies That Don't Fit the "Yoga" Mold

It is crucial to address that "wellness" spaces are often physically inaccessible. If you are in a larger body, if you use a mobility aid, or if you have chronic fatigue, the standard advice (Go for a run! Do hot yoga!) is not only unhelpful but dangerous.

Body Positive Wellness for Disabled and Larger Bodies:

  • Seated exercises: You can build cardiovascular health while seated.
  • Swimming: Zero impact, accessible for joint pain and larger bodies.
  • Rest as resistance: In a culture that worships hustle, choosing rest when you are fatigued is a revolutionary act of self-care.
  • Advocacy: True wellness is also demanding ramps, wider seats, and inclusive changing rooms at gyms.

Redefining Wellness: How Body Positivity is Saving Us from the Diet Trap

For decades, the wellness industry sold us a simple equation: Thin = Healthy = Worthy. The glossy magazines, the detox teas, the "clean eating" challenges—they all pointed toward a single, narrow destination: a specific body shape.

But a quiet revolution has been brewing. The body positivity movement has crashed the gates of the wellness world, and it is forcing a long-overdue question: What if wellness actually felt good for everyone?

The marriage of body positivity and wellness isn't about abandoning health. It is about rescuing it from the clutches of shame.

The Old Paradigm: Wellness as Punishment

Traditional wellness was rooted in correction. We worked out to "burn off" yesterday's pasta. We started a "reset" because we felt guilty about the weekend. We moved our bodies not out of joy, but out of fear of taking up too much space.

This approach has a fatal flaw: You cannot hate yourself into a version of yourself that you love.

When wellness is driven by body shame, it becomes unsustainable. It leads to the binge-restrict cycle, obsessive tracking, and eventual burnout. Worse, it excludes anyone who doesn't fit the mold—plus-size individuals, people with disabilities, those with chronic illness.

The Nuance: Where It Gets Tricky

To be fair, the conversation is not always simple. Some critics argue that body positivity ignores the genuine health risks associated with higher weights (like heart disease or joint stress). But here is the counterpoint: You cannot diagnose or treat a person based on their jeans size. Health behaviors matter more than body size. A thin person who smokes and never sleeps is not "well." A larger person who eats vibrantly, moves joyfully, and manages stress is well.

True body-positive wellness advocates for Health at Every Size (HAES)—which argues that people of all sizes deserve access to evidence-based healthcare, joyful movement, and nutritious food, without being reduced to a number on a scale.
